BIRTHDAY PARTY

A delightful party was held at the residence of Mr. and Mrs. F. Green. Shackleton Road, Mount Eden, on Monday evening in honour of their daughter Orma’s birthday. The guest of honour was gowned in blue crepe de chine and silver lace, and received many pretty and useful gifts. The house was gaily decorated with streamers and flowers of autumn tints, and the evening was enjoyably spent in musical items, games and dancing. Duets played by Mrs. Green and Orma were much appreciated, also items by Miss Peggy Patterson, Gabriel Marshall, Kathleen O’Malley and Elsie Dye. Mrs. Green received her guests in a gown of black floral crepe de chine. Among those present were: Mrs. McGarry, wearing navy bine crepe de chine, beautifully embroid€red: Mrs. Clark, Mrs. Patterson, Mrs. Egginton, Mrs. Empson, and Mrs. Mulqueeney; Misses Clark. Joan Egginton, Kathleen O’Malley, Peggy Patterson, Gabriel Marshall, Marjory Read, Masters Noel Green. Raymond Green, Laurie Mulqueeney, Ormond Mulqueeney and Claude Empson. Prizes were won by Miss Kathleen O’Malley, Marjory Read, and Elsie Dye.
